数据库初始数据是什么
-
数据库初始数据是指在创建数据库时,为了方便使用和测试,系统自动提供的一组初始数据。这些初始数据可以包括表格、视图、存储过程、触发器等数据库对象的定义,以及这些对象中的一些示例数据。
数据库初始数据的作用是为用户提供一个基础的数据环境,使其能够快速开始使用数据库系统。它可以包含一些常用的数据,以便用户在进行开发和测试时能够进行实际的操作和验证。
数据库初始数据的内容通常根据具体的需求而定,可以是一些常用的示例数据,也可以是一些模拟的测试数据。例如,在一个学生管理系统中,初始数据可以包括学生表、课程表、成绩表等,并向这些表中插入一些示例数据,以便用户能够进行学生信息查询、课程安排和成绩统计等操作。
数据库初始数据的生成可以通过手动插入数据或者使用自动化工具来实现。在数据库系统中,通常会提供一些初始化脚本或者配置文件,用户可以根据自己的需求进行修改和执行,以生成适合自己的初始数据。
总之,数据库初始数据是数据库系统为了方便用户使用和测试而提供的一组基础数据,它包含了一些数据库对象的定义以及一些示例数据。通过使用初始数据,用户可以快速开始使用数据库,并进行开发和测试工作。
1年前 -
数据库的初始数据是指在数据库创建时,预先填充的数据。这些数据可以是默认的示例数据,也可以是已有的真实数据。初始数据的目的是为了在数据库建立后,使其具备一些基本的可用数据,方便用户进行测试和开发。
下面是关于数据库初始数据的五个重要点:
-
数据库设计:在创建数据库时,需要先进行数据库设计。数据库设计是指根据需求和业务逻辑,确定数据库的表结构、字段以及关系。在数据库设计过程中,可以考虑将一些常用的数据作为初始数据填入数据库中。
-
默认值和约束:数据库表中的字段可以设置默认值和约束。默认值是指当插入数据时,如果没有指定该字段的值,则会使用默认值。约束是指对字段值的限制,例如唯一约束、非空约束等。在创建表时,可以设置一些默认值和约束,以确保初始数据的正确性和完整性。
-
示例数据:示例数据是指用于演示或测试的数据。在创建数据库时,可以预先插入一些示例数据,以展示数据库的功能和使用方法。示例数据通常是模拟真实数据的一部分,但并不真实存在的数据。
-
导入数据:在创建数据库后,可以通过导入数据的方式将初始数据填入数据库中。导入数据可以使用数据库管理工具或编程语言提供的API。常见的数据导入格式包括CSV、JSON和SQL等。
-
数据库迁移:数据库迁移是指在数据库已经创建并使用后,需要对数据库进行结构或数据的变更。在数据库迁移过程中,也可以考虑添加或修改初始数据。数据库迁移工具可以帮助管理和执行数据库迁移操作,确保数据库结构和数据的一致性。
总结起来,数据库的初始数据是在数据库创建时填入的一些基本数据,可以是默认值、示例数据或导入的数据。初始数据的目的是为了方便测试和开发,以及展示数据库的功能和使用方法。数据库设计和迁移是关于初始数据的重要方面,可以通过设置默认值、约束和导入数据来管理和维护初始数据。
1年前 -
-
数据库的初始数据是指在创建数据库之后,数据库中已经存在的数据。这些数据通常是在数据库设计和开发过程中预先定义的,用于模拟真实的数据环境,以便于数据库的测试、调试和演示。
数据库的初始数据可以包括表、视图、存储过程、触发器等对象以及这些对象所包含的数据。下面将从方法、操作流程等方面讲解数据库初始数据的生成和使用。
一、生成初始数据的方法:
-
手动插入数据:通过SQL语句手动插入数据是最常见的方法之一。可以使用INSERT INTO语句将数据逐条插入到数据库表中。
-
导入外部数据:如果已经有其他数据源的数据,可以通过导入的方式将数据导入数据库。常见的导入方式包括使用数据库管理工具的导入功能、使用ETL工具进行数据转换和导入、使用编程语言编写脚本进行数据导入等。
-
使用数据生成工具:有一些专门的工具可以用于生成测试数据。这些工具可以根据指定的规则和约束自动生成大量的测试数据,包括随机数据、模拟数据等。
二、操作流程:
-
创建数据库:首先需要创建一个数据库,可以使用数据库管理工具或SQL语句来创建数据库。
-
创建表结构:根据实际需求,创建数据库表结构。可以使用数据库管理工具的图形界面来创建表结构,也可以使用SQL语句来创建表。
-
插入初始数据:根据需求,使用上述方法之一插入初始数据。可以根据表结构和数据需求编写SQL语句,逐条插入数据,也可以使用导入工具将外部数据导入到数据库中。
-
验证数据:插入完初始数据后,需要验证数据是否正确插入。可以使用SQL查询语句来查询数据,检查数据是否符合预期。
-
调试和修改:如果发现数据有误或需要修改,可以通过修改SQL语句或重新插入数据来进行调试和修改。
三、数据库初始数据的使用:
-
数据库测试:初始数据可以用于数据库的测试,包括功能测试、性能测试、安全性测试等。通过使用真实的数据进行测试,可以更好地模拟真实环境,提高测试的准确性和可信度。
-
数据库演示:初始数据可以用于数据库的演示和展示。可以通过查询、报表等方式展示数据库中的数据,以便用户了解数据库的功能和效果。
-
数据库调试:初始数据可以用于数据库的调试。在调试过程中,可以通过查询数据、修改数据等方式,检查数据库的运行情况,找出问题并进行修复。
总结:
数据库的初始数据是在创建数据库之后已经存在的数据。生成初始数据的方法包括手动插入数据、导入外部数据和使用数据生成工具。操作流程包括创建数据库、创建表结构、插入初始数据、验证数据和调试修改。初始数据可以用于数据库的测试、演示和调试,提高数据库的可信度和效果。1年前 -